An Egyptian actor who graduated from the Institute of Dramatic Arts in 1961. He joined the theatrical television troupe, and the first show he appeared in was Something in My Chest directed by Nour El-Demerdash, then he presented plays including The Land, Sheikh Ragab, Backstreets, and Empty Hearts. His work in television drama includes the series Al-Zaher Baibars and After the Storm. His notable film roles include Cry of An Ant, The Pleasure Market, and Silence Sons.
